Sprite3D
|
||
========
|
||
|
||
**Hérite de :** :ref:`SpriteBase3D<class_SpriteBase3D>` **<** :ref:`GeometryInstance3D<class_GeometryInstance3D>` **<** :ref:`VisualInstance3D<class_VisualInstance3D>` **<** :ref:`Node3D<class_Node3D>` **<** :ref:`Node<class_Node>` **<** :ref:`Object<class_Object>`
|
||
|
||
Nœud de sprite en 2D dans un monde en 3D.
|
||
|
||
.. rst-class:: classref-introduction-group
|
||
|
||
Description
|
||
-----------
|
||
|
||
A node that displays a 2D texture in a 3D environment. The texture displayed can be a region from a larger atlas texture, or a frame from a sprite sheet animation. See also :ref:`SpriteBase3D<class_SpriteBase3D>` where properties such as the billboard mode are defined.

:ref:`int<class_int>` **frame** = ``0`` :ref:`🔗<class_Sprite3D_property_frame>`
|
||
|
||
.. rst-class:: classref-property-setget
|
||
|
||
- |void| **set_frame**\ (\ value\: :ref:`int<class_int>`\ )
|
||
- :ref:`int<class_int>` **get_frame**\ (\ )
|
||
|
||
Trame actuelle à afficher à partir de la feuille de sprite. :ref:`hframes<class_Sprite3D_property_hframes>` ou :ref:`vframes<class_Sprite3D_property_vframes>` doivent être supérieurs à 1. Cette propriété est automatiquement rajustée lorsque :ref:`hframes<class_Sprite3D_property_hframes>` ou :ref:`vframes<class_Sprite3D_property_vframes>` sont modifiés pour garder le pointage sur la même trame visuelle (même colonne et rangée). Si c'est impossible, cette valeur est réinitialisée à ``0``.

:ref:`int<class_int>` **hframes** = ``1`` :ref:`🔗<class_Sprite3D_property_hframes>`
|
||
|
||
.. rst-class:: classref-property-setget
|
||
|
||
- |void| **set_hframes**\ (\ value\: :ref:`int<class_int>`\ )
|
||
- :ref:`int<class_int>` **get_hframes**\ (\ )
|
||
|
||
The number of columns in the sprite sheet. When this property is changed, :ref:`frame<class_Sprite3D_property_frame>` is adjusted so that the same visual frame is maintained (same row and column). If that's impossible, :ref:`frame<class_Sprite3D_property_frame>` is reset to ``0``.
